Should You Clean Your House Before or After Vacation in Winthrop, MA? Preventive Cleaning & More

Preparing for a vacation involves more than just packing bags and booking flights. It’s essential to ensure your home is clean and secure before you leave and to return to a clean, welcoming space afterward. Should You Clean Your House Before Going on Vacation?

1) Kitchen and Pantry: Start by cleaning out perishable items from your refrigerator to avoid coming back to unpleasant odors. Dispose of any food that might spoil while you’re away. Wipe down counters, appliances, and the inside of the microwave to prevent attracting pests.
2) Trash and Recycling: Empty all trash cans throughout the house, including bathrooms and bedrooms. Consider recycling any items that may accumulate odors during your absence.
3) Laundry: Wash and put away any dirty laundry to prevent mold or mildew from forming in damp clothes. It’s a good idea to change bedding as well.
4) Bathroom: Clean sinks, toilets, and showers to prevent the buildup of grime. Consider using a bathroom cleaner that provides lasting protection to help maintain cleanliness.
5) General Tidying: Declutter common areas and organize surfaces. Put away items that might attract dust or clutter your space.
6) Security Checks: Double-check all windows and doors to ensure they are locked securely. This step not only enhances security but also prevents energy loss.

Why Should I Clean My House After Vacation?

1) Open Windows: Air out your home by opening windows and allowing fresh air to circulate. This helps eliminate any stale odors that may have developed during your absence.
2) Unpack and Do Laundry: Unpack your luggage promptly to avoid clutter. Wash any dirty clothes immediately to prevent lingering odors and stains from setting.
3) Vacuum and Dust: Start by vacuuming floors, carpets, and upholstery to remove any dirt or debris brought in during your travels. Dust surfaces such as shelves, tables, and countertops to eliminate settled dust.
4) Restock Essentials: Check your pantry and refrigerator for any expired items or products that need replenishing. Restock toiletries in bathrooms and replace any items that were used up.
5) Clean Bathrooms and Kitchen: Give your bathrooms and kitchen a thorough cleaning to restore them to their pre-vacation state. Pay attention to sinks, countertops, and toilets to ensure cleanliness.
6) Check for Pests: Inspect your home for any signs of pests that may have entered while you were away. Address any issues promptly to prevent infestations.
7) Adjust Thermostat: If you adjusted your thermostat before leaving, set it back to your desired temperature now that you’re home. This helps maintain comfort and energy efficiency.
